; /** * Resolves the {@link ObligationType} subclass for the given tag. * * **Reserve-addresses only** (a single mint can map to a float-rate reserve plus multiple * fixed-rate reserves — mint alone is ambiguous). Variable-rate tags (1/2/3) derive their * mint seeds from the supplied reserve address via {@link KaminoMarket.getExistingReserveByAddress}; * fixed-rate tags (4/5/6) use the reserve address directly as the seed. * * @param reserveAddress1 deposit/collateral reserve. Required for every non-Vanilla tag. * @param reserveAddress2 borrow/debt reserve. Required for Multiply/Leverage (variable and fixed-rate). */ export declare function getObligationType(kaminoMarket: KaminoMarket, obligationTag: ObligationTypeTag, reserveAddress1?: Option
, reserveAddress2?: Option
): ObligationType; export declare function getObligationTypeFromObligation(kaminoMarket: KaminoMarket, obligation: KaminoObligation): ObligationType; //# sourceMappingURL=ObligationType.d.ts.map
